- Verified traveler (10/5): - From the views, to the staff, to the abbey, to the food this was a fantastic experience! We checked in and even with a slight language barrier, we were treated warmly by the people who run it. The meal... just amazing. We had the gnocchi, chicken dish, apple pie with vanilla gelato... the chef even sent us a roast pork that was truly a great dish on its own. The rooms felt cozy and authentic, the beds were perfection, the abbey cat even gave us a visit! The next morning we explored the surroundings. Take some time in the abbey, it's not just beautiful but felt very spiritual and awe inspiring. This felt like we weren't tourists, but really got something from the experience of just being in Italy. I loved it!

- Simonetta (10/5): suggestivo alloggio addossato ad abbazia del XII s - Una rilassante vacanza immersi nel verde oro delle colline marchigiane: poche stanze ricavate all'interno del complesso di un'abbazia medievale, molto ben ristrutturato e dotato di tutti i comfort. Molto accogliente e disponibile il personale (soprattutto il sig. Pio), ottima cucina tipica marchigiana, con prodotti di 1^ qualita'; camera sempre ben pulita (manca la TV). Unico neo: le stanze all'ultimo piano possono risultare troppo calde per l'assenza della climatizzazione. Nel complesso giudizio ottimo.
